For the first question about the base of the common logarithm (denoted as $\log$), by definition, the common logarithm has a base of 10.
For the second question about the base of the natural logarithm (denoted as $\ln$), by definition, the natural logarithm has a base of the mathematical constant $e$ (Euler's number).
